Pertamina Supports Jambi City Government’s Efforts to Prevent Subsidized Fuel Abuse
Jambi, January 8, 2024 – In an effort to monitor the distribution of subsidized fuel, the City Government through the Transportation Agency in Jambi City will activate a Joint Team to minimize the misuse of subsidized fuel in the city.
Head of the Transportation Agency in Jambi City, Saleh Ridho, stated that the activation of this Joint Team is due to the numerous vehicles misusing subsidized fuel for resale purposes. “In carrying out the operations of this Joint Team, the Transportation Agency in Jambi City has coordinated with Pertamina to help block the license plate numbers of vehicles that have been proven to misuse subsidized fuel,” he said.
Area Manager of Communication, Relations & CSR at Pertamina Patra Niaga Regional Sumbagsel, Tjahyo Nikho Indrawan, expressed Pertamina’s support for the program initiated by the Transportation Agency in Jambi City to ensure that the distribution of subsidized fuel is more targeted. “We welcome the synergy of the Jambi City Government, which continues to actively collaborate with us in monitoring the distribution of subsidized fuel and promoting fair energy, as there are still many users who misuse subsidized fuel that they are not entitled to consume,” Nikho stated.
On the other hand, Sales Area Manager Retail in Jambi, Bima Kusuma Aji, explained that in realizing targeted distribution, Pertamina continues to enhance synergy with local governments, the police, and also invites the public to participate in monitoring and reporting any deviations or improper distributions. “We have also emphasized to all distributors to distribute subsidized fuel in accordance with applicable regulations, and we will not hesitate to impose sanctions if there are gas stations that engage in any form of cheating related to the distribution of subsidized fuel,” Bima emphasized.
